Judith A. Bailey (nee Piombo), age 68 of Wayne, died peacefully on Saturday, September 25, 2021. She has lived in Wayne her entire life.

Judy graduated from Wayne Valley High School with the class of 1971 and had worked at Builder’s Emporium on Hamburg Turnpike, although none of us are sure what she really did there! Chris Bailey was a regular customer there, and romance grew between the two of them. Chris mustered the courage to propose and they were married on October 15, 1978. They honeymooned in Hawaii, visiting Honolulu and Maui, and settled in Wayne upon their return.

Judy was an incredible homemaker, keeping her house absolutely spotless! She would vacuum so often that her husband accused her of ‘vacuum abuse!’ But that was just her thing; keeping a neat and tidy house at all times. She would watch the Hallmark channel to relax, and summer vacations to Ortley and Lavallette were among her favorite places to visit. Judy was also a very selfless person, putting most other people’s happiness and needs before her own. She was particularly good at building long lasting, genuine friendships. She has known her closest girlfriends for decades, and some of them since grammar school! Judy made a point to call most of them every day. She always remained close with her sisters and brother as well. All of those relationships were so deeply a part of who she was that even as she struggled with Alzheimer’s disease in recent years, Judy would still remember to call her sisters and friends daily. Chris would help her to dial the phone, and she often told the same stories over and over, but she never forgot to make those calls. She called her son and daughter every day, without fail. Judy also adored her daughter-in-law, Jennifer, and they have enjoyed a very close and loving relationship as well. Judy was always asking about her daughter’s boyfriend, Tony. She sincerely cared for all of them, and loved them deeply. Her dog, Frankie, a miniature Husky, was also a recipient of her devotion.

In recent years, Judy was lovingly cared for by her home-health aid, Deana. They too established a very close bond. And Judy’s sisters: Donna and Lois, as well as her brother Albert, and all of their spouses, visited with Judy frequently. It brought Judy great comfort to be surrounded by so many loving and caring friends and relatives, especially during these past few years.

Judy is survived by her loving husband, Christopher Bailey of Wayne, her two children; Amanda and her boyfriend Tony Buccino of Hackensack, and Thomas Bailey and his wife Jennifer of Ramsey, her siblings; Lois McPeek and her husband Kenneth of Cedar Knolls, Donna Franzini and her husband Anthony of Cedar Knolls, Albert Piombo and his wife Suzanne of Wayne, and Patrice Dydo and her husband John of St. Cloud, Florida, and many dear, loving friends. She was predeceased by her parents; Dominick "Mickey" Piombo (2012) and Fay Piombo (2019).
